Kvaesitso. It's the only FOSS app I found that supports folders within the drawer. Well, at least it was the closest thing to it; You can select a tag and apps with that tag is shown to you. I really don't like how most launchers treats app drawer like a app dump. I miss the folder feature in Nova launcher.
